Sharing the road with emergency vehicles – RSA advice

The Road Safety Authority  of Ireland (RSA) has recently launched a safety advice booklet for motorists on sharing the road with emergency vehicles. The distant sound of sirens or the view of flashing blue lights can often signal the start of a dilemma for a motorist – how should they safely and quickly assist the emergency vehicle?

The RSA booklet gives plenty of tips and useful advice to motorists on how they can help these emergency vehicles whilst still staying safe on the road. The overall advice is not to panic. Instead plan and indicate your intentions well in advance. A full copy of the booklet is available from the RSA website’s publication section. Hard copies can also be requested from the RSA.
